I have been using Perplexity for a couple of months and enjoy the free service and power of using AI search. Here are a couple of excerpts from a WSJ article today (might be behind paywall):
"Perplexity, an artificial-intelligence startup aiming to challenge Google’s dominance in web search, is finalizing a new funding deal at around a $1 billion valuation, people familiar with the matter said, roughly doubling its valuation since its most recent financing a few months ago......
.....Perplexity’s search tool answers user queries with a detailed summary and links to where it pulled the information. Users are then able to ask follow-up questions. The company has seen an uptick in subscribers of its premium service, which charges $20 a month for a more powerful version of the search engine that uses GPT-4, OpenAI’s most advanced AI model"
